First off, why does adhesion matter? When it comes to container strip seals, good adhesion to metal surfaces is crucial. Containers are constantly exposed to various environmental conditions - from scorching heat in the desert to freezing cold in polar regions. They also face vibrations during transportation, whether by ship, train, or truck. A strip seal with poor adhesion won't be able to keep its position, which means it can't effectively protect the contents inside the container from moisture, dust, and pests.

Now, let's talk about the science behind adhesion. Adhesion is the attraction between two different substances. In the case of strip seals and metal surfaces, we're looking at how well the seal material sticks to the metal. There are a few factors that can affect this adhesion.

One of the key factors is the type of material used for the strip seal. Most container strip seals are made from rubber, such as EPDM (Ethylene Propylene Diene Monomer). EPDM is a popular choice because it's resistant to weathering, ozone, and UV radiation. But its adhesion properties can vary depending on how it's formulated. Some EPDM compounds are specifically designed to have better adhesion to metal. These compounds often contain special additives that enhance the chemical bonding between the rubber and the metal surface.

Another factor is the surface condition of the metal. A clean, smooth metal surface will generally provide better adhesion than a dirty or rough one. Rust, oil, and dirt can act as barriers between the seal and the metal, preventing proper bonding. That's why it's important to clean the metal surface before installing the strip seal. You can use a mild detergent and a clean cloth to remove any contaminants. If there's rust on the metal, you may need to use a rust remover and then sand the surface to make it smooth.

The installation process also plays a big role in adhesion. When installing the strip seal, it's important to apply even pressure along the entire length of the seal. This helps to ensure that the seal makes full contact with the metal surface. Some strip seals come with an adhesive backing, which can make installation easier and improve adhesion. However, you still need to make sure that the adhesive is applied correctly and that there are no air bubbles trapped between the seal and the metal.

So, do strip seals for containers have a good adhesion to metal surfaces? In most cases, yes. When the right materials are used, the metal surface is properly prepared, and the installation is done correctly, strip seals can form a strong bond with metal surfaces. But it's not always a guarantee. There are some situations where adhesion may be a problem.

For example, if the container is exposed to extreme temperatures for a long period of time, the adhesion between the seal and the metal may weaken. High temperatures can cause the rubber to expand and contract, which can put stress on the bond. Similarly, if the container is subjected to frequent vibrations, the seal may start to loosen over time.
